SUMMARY:
It can be difficult to construct a realistic schedule early in the acquisition lifecycle due to the limited certainty of requirements, design decisions, and other key elements of program planning. Understanding risk and uncertainty in a schedule is essential, and the GAO Scheduling Guide includes “Conducting a Schedule Risk Analysis” as one of the 10 Best Practices. A Schedule Risk Analysis (SRA) can provide quantitative insight into potential areas of delay along with associated cost impacts. However, a well-formed SRA requires clear input and structured analysis of risk events and uncertainty. In this presentation, we will discuss how to address schedule risk in low maturity projects by investigating different risk modeling techniques, reviewing existing guidance on schedule risk, and analyzing how uncertainty analysis must be interpreted and applied early in the project lifecycle.
